Tiny boutique suitable for various uses just renovated in the center of Urbino. The small place is enhanced by the presence of a ceramic floor decorated completely by hand.
The small boutique is located in a central and strategic street since it connects the bus station and a large shopping mall with the wonderful historic center of this renaissance village.
The place has a display window overlooking Via Bramante and consists of a main room, a small corridor located in the raised floor connected to a bathroom with a shower. Finally, a loft can be reached with a staircase.
The charm of this shop is linked to the faithful recovery of some original materials. We find that the ceiling of the bathroom consists of old beams cleaned, the corridor has an original vaulted ceiling and in the main room a wound in the wall shows the stones on which the building stands.
A pink stone sink is present in the corridor. Walnut wood is used to surround the artistic floor. At the end of the corridor ceramic tiles depict the Ducal Palace of Urbino.
